BIO:
Hi everyone, my name is Leigh and I'm a happy, houndy girl who's looking for my furever family! I am a sweet and loyal girl and I love to hang out with my people, preferably while being petted. I don't mean to brag, but I've already completed 2 beginner training classes, so when we do our required training class together, I'm sure to be the star! Plus, training is a great way for us to get to know each other and bond.
I can be a bit of a barker with new people or unfamiliar situations, so I'm looking for a confident or dog-savvy person who'll help me continue to practice staying cool when I'm unsure. Young kids are also pretty scary to me, so I'd do best with older children. My foster home has a fenced yard where I love to play fetch and do zoomies, but I don't need one as long as I get my two walks and some playtime every day. Puzzle toys and training are also great ways to keep my brain busy and tire me out! While it's fun to be busy, I also enjoy long naps and I'll even see myself to my crate when I've had enough.
I walk nicely on leash and can ignore most of those awful squirrels. A canine playmate may be great fun, let's meet first and see how it goes! I am also friendly with cats, as well.
